Generate larger faction bases. Their size and manpower evolve with time. It also factors in the difficulty level, and some randomness. A high-risk, high-reward challenge.

Safe to add/remove in-game.

For compatibility with other mods changing faction bases, check Choose your enemy base from BrokenBed.
